Estimating and modeling space-time correlation structures
In this paper, a class of product-sum covariance models has been introduced for estimating and modeling space-time correlation structures. It is shown how the coefficients of this class of models are related to the global sill and "partial" spatial and temporal sills; moreover, some constraints on these sills have been given in order to assure positive definiteness of the product-sum covariance model. A brief comparative study with some other classes of spatial-temporal covariance models has been pointed out.
